最小二乘法excel

在Excel中實現最小二乘法擬合,可以使用以下步驟:

  1. 輸入數據:首先,在Excel表格中輸入數據。這些數據應包括自變數(X)和因變數(Y)。
  2. 創建輔助列:在Y的數據值旁邊,創建一列新數據,這些數據應該是Y的線性函式的形式,如Y = aX + b。例如,如果使用線性回歸模型,b的公式將是Y = aX + n,其中n是Y的值。在Excel中,可以使用「插入」選單中的「插入函式」功能將公式寫入單元格。
  3. 複製填充:將公式套用於所有X值和相應的Y值。可以通過拖動填充柄來實現複製填充。
  4. 調整斜率:在結果單元格中,Excel將顯示斜率(a)。您可能需要調整這個值以獲得最佳擬合。在「格式」選單中選擇「數字」,然後在「分類」下選擇「公式」。在單元格中輸入 = SUMPRODUCT(($B$2:$B$n-$A$2):($C$2:$C$n*B2)/($C$2:$C$n+1)),這將自動計算斜率。
  5. 調整截距:通過在結果單元格中減去斜率(a),您將得到截距(b)。您可能需要調整這個值以獲得最佳擬合。
  6. 測試模型:可以使用公式欄下方的「預測」功能來預測新的數據點。如果預測值與實際值之間的差異較小,則說明擬合模型是有效的。

請注意,這只是使用Excel進行最小二乘法擬合的基本步驟。對於更複雜的數據集或特定的擬合需求,可能需要使用更高級的工具或方法。